  12. A quick note (it is no longer quick, i wrote so much it turns out)
    as someone who's a massive fan of crypt tv (or at least was until they started shilling crypto a few years back but whatever lol) there is a bit more nuance, specifically with the Look See. You were pretty bang on with the other two, though the characterization of the birch can shift a bit too (intially, she was introduced as a caring protector who dealt with threats through violent means, but they later expanded on that to show that shes more driven by pact than morals, and wont hesitate to kill innocents if its needed to protect someone)
    Anyway, the Look See is hard to pin down because theres a lot of questions about how he works and how he thinks. Theres a case to be made for your interpretation, but theres also a very strong case to be made that he doesnt actually care about the guilt itself, hes more just bloodthirsty and is confined by the rules by which he works. As in, being faced with someone suffering from guilt is just letting something that already wanted to kill them off of its leash. Theres some other interpretations too, but its hard to really pin down specifics because they never really delved into personality, hes presented more like a force of nature, with characterization just in how he goes about what he does itself.
    The idea of where he should fit on the list can vary a lot with this in mind. This could be anything from giving him a feeding ground to forcing him out of his element, and we just dont know enough to say for sure. Overall, I'd argue he should go in one of the middle sections though. You can sort of apply the logic you used for animalistic killers, just with the caveat that he probably has human level intelligence underneath that, too
